Villarreal – Espanyol, getty images February 10, 2026, 12:05 AM
The hosts opened the scoring in the middle of the first half. After a cross from Buchanan’s wing, Giorgi Mikoutadze sent the ball into Dmytrovych’s net with a spectacular free kick. Soon after, Villarreal doubled the advantage — Moleiro broke into the penalty area, after which the ball ricocheted off Salinas and ended up in the visitors’ own goal.
After the break, the yellow submarine did not slow down. At the beginning of the second half, Nicolas Pepe took advantage of a defensive error and scored a crushing goal with an accurate shot. The final point in the match was put by Leandro Cabrera, who distinguished himself with a goal at the end of the meeting, but this ball did not affect the overall course of the game.
The win moved Villarreal level on points with Atletico Madrid in the La Liga standings with a game in hand.
Villarreal – Espanyol 4:1
Goals: Mikautadze, 35, Salinas (ag), 41, Pepe, 50, Moleiro, 55 – Cabrera, 88
